DESCRIPTION:A guide to Government contracts – Series of 4 workshops \nRochford District Council\, Southend-on-Sea City Council and Launchpad Southend are pleased to provide local businesses with a series of FREE new workshops designed to help your business navigate the world of Government contracts! Join us at Launchpad for four interactive sessions where you will learn everything you need to know about securing and managing Government contracts. Whether you’re a small business owner or a seasoned entrepreneur\, these workshops will provide you with valuable insights and practical tips to succeed in the competitive Government contracting space. Don’t miss out on this opportunity to expand your business horizons! \nThese workshops are hosted by Launchpad Southend and delivered by BIZphit LLP. The series is fully funded by Rochford District Council (using UK Government UKSPF) and Southend-on-Sea City Council. There are 12 places available for Rochford District* based businesses and 12 places for those within Southend-on-Sea – on a first come first served basis. \nA light lunch with refreshments and networking opportunity at the end of each workshop is included. \nYou do not need to attend all 4 workshops in the series\, however by attending all 4\, BizPhit will be able to guide your business through every part of the tendering process. Workshop dates and content as follows: \nFriday 26 September 2025 – 10 am until 1 pm \nWorkshop 1: Preparing for Your Public Sector Tender \n  \nFriday 31 October 2025 – 10 am until 1 pm \nWorkshop 2: Tender Fitness Review & Development \n  \nFriday 28 November 2025 – 10 am until 1 pm \nWorkshop 3: Demystifying Tender Responses & Using AI Effectively \n  \nFriday 23 January 2026 – 10 am until 1 pm \nWorkshop 4: AI in Tendering – Practical\, Compliant & Competitive Use

DESCRIPTION:OverviewThis workshop is designed for micro and small businesses looking to take their first steps into public sector tendering. If you’re aiming to win lower-value tenders and requests for quotations (RFQs) but feel overwhelmed by procurement jargon\, this session will help you build confidence and clarity. \nWhat You’ll Learn \n\nHow to access public sector opportunities\nUnderstanding procurement thresholds and routes to market\nAssessing your business’s readiness to supply\nResponding effectively to technical questions in tenders\n\nOutcomes \n\nA clear understanding of procurement basics\nKnowledge of essential documents and policies\nConfidence in answering tender questions\nA practical action plan to improve your tender readiness\n\nDeliveryThis workshop is hosted by Launchpad Southend and delivered by BIZphit LLP. It is fully funded by Southend-on-Sea City Council and Rochford District Council. \nYou do not need to attend all 4 workshops in the series but parts 2-4 will guide your business through every part of the tendering process. Future workshops as follows: \nWorkshop 2: Tender Fitness Review & Development – 31st Oct 2025 \nWorkshop 3: Demystifying Tender Responses & Using AI Effectively – 28th Nov 2025 \nWorkshop 4: AI in Tendering – Practical\, Compliant & Competitive Use – 23rd Jan 2026

DESCRIPTION:Do you know how to get the most out of Facebook for your business? \nFacebook is the world’s largest social media platform. It has around 50 million active users in the UK and is popular with people of all regions\, income levels\, genders\, and educational backgrounds. \nNot many of us have the budget to hire dedicated staff or third-party agencies to run our account\, so how do you get the most out of Facebook and use it to attract new followers and engagement without this? \nJoin us for an informative and practical workshop which will provide an overview of how to best utilise Facebook for your organisation – vital when you have limited time and resources. \nTo make this workshop as bespoke as possible we will ask you a few short questions when you register in order for us to understand the needs of the group\, but we will cover the following areas: \n•    The importance of marketing on social media for business\n•    How to create compelling and engaging posts\n•    Practical examples of what works and what doesn’t\n•    Using Facebook to recruit and inspire future employees\n•    A chance to share your own experiences and learn from others\n•    How to schedule posts in advance and work smarter\n•    Facebook features explained\, including Stories and Reels\n•    A brief overview of the Meta Business Suite and Facebook Insights\n•    The importance of scheduling and calendars. \nOur social media workshops are popular\, and places are limited\, so please book early to avoid disappointment. \nWho Should Attend\nThis training is for staff who have the responsibility of social media as part of their role and have a good working knowledge of Facebook\, but do not necessarily have a working knowledge of how to make the platform work best for their business. This course will assist in gaining that understanding and how to tailor it to established business goals. \nWhat’s Included \n\nThe workshop lasts for 2 hours but further time is available at the end for any outstanding questions or queries.\nAfter the workshop\, we will send you a pack containing all the advice\, tips and links discussed during the session.\nYou will also be able to pass on follow-up questions to our trainers\, SRX Consultancy\, who will offer practical support (via email or a quick call) to ensure you are able to put everything you learned into action.\n\nAbout the Trainers\nSRX Consultancy is a boutique PR\, social media and communications agency specialising in areas including charity and small business. Their bespoke and tailored training sessions have been running for 10 years – attended by staff from hundreds of charities\, organisations\, and small businesses\, always receiving positive feedback. This workshop will be delivered by Simon Rothstein and Lauren Soar. \nDate:   Tuesday 2 December 2025  10.00am to 12.00pm\nVirtual:  Zoom Platform\nCost to attend:  Members £95.00 + VAT and Non-Members £150.00 + VAT \nPlease note: This event will not be recorded and any material will only be circulated to those that attend

DESCRIPTION:A friendly\, supportive and productive virtual networking event for entrepreneurs in the military community. \nThis is a unique joint partnership between X-Forces Enterprise (XFE) and the Federation of Small Businesses (FSB) to provide regular opportunities to bring together business owners from the Armed Forces community to network\, exchange knowledge\, and build contacts across the whole of the UK. \nEvent Highlights \nThese focused events are a great option for businesses led by members of the military community who may be new to networking and looking for a friendly place to start. Equally\, it is a great opportunity for those with more networking experience who would like to grow their contacts within a community of inspiring business leaders. \nStructure \nThe event will feature a brief presentation from a former member of the Armed Forces community (TBC) who is now active in the business environment. Following this\, the meeting will move into breakout rooms\, allowing attendees the space for further discussion on the theme or to share any other topics of interest. This is a space to network in a friendly and supportive environment. \n\nHost – Ren Kapur MBE \n \nRen Kapur MBE is founder and CEO of X-Forces Enterprise\, established in 2013. \nA social entrepreneur\, Ren has harnessed her experience to enable individuals and communities to support themselves and thrive through enterprise. In doing so she has brought together corporate\, government\, and charity stakeholders at the very highest levels. \nRen was awarded an MBE for service to the Entrepreneurship in 2016 in the Queen’s 90th Birthday Honours list and is a Reservist in the British Army; a Visiting Fellow at Lord Ashcroft’s Business School\, Armed Forces Champion for the Federation of Small Businesses\, and newly-appointed board member and SME Lead for Enterprise M3 LEP. \nGuest Speaker – Adam Casey – tmc3 Ltd \nRAF veteran Adam Casey co-founded tmc3 to redefine cybersecurity consultancy\, placing people\, not just technology\, at its heart. Leaving behind a corporate career\, he launched his business with no external backing\, guided by a bold vision to create a values-led\, veteran-founded company. \nSince 2020\, tmc3 has grown by 86% year-on-year\, working with dozens of organisations including Parliament\, the Ministry of Defence\, the NHS\, and major infrastructure bodies. But it’s not just commercial success that sets them apart\, it’s their commitment to community. Over one-third of Adam’s team are veterans and tmc3 actively mentors service leavers\, helping them transition into rewarding tech careers. \nAudience \nThis is a joint venture between X-Forces Enterprise and FSB. The networking sessions are open to all businesses – both FSB members and non-members\, XFE beneficiaries and non-beneficiaries so please feel free to share with your networks. #FSBConnectOnline #MilitaryinBusiness \nAlthough this event could be particularly useful to veterans\, service leavers\, reserves\, cadets and their families\, everyone is welcome to embrace the wider business community\, grow community cohesion\, and exchange knowledge. \nCommitment to our Communities \nSince its inception in 2013\, XFE’s mission has been to provide members of the wider military family (transitioning service personnel\, veterans\, their families\, reservists\, cadets and beyond) with the tools to make informed decisions about their future and\, through enterprise skills training\, empower them to reach their career potential.
